The Trustee Board plays a vital role in the organisation, steering and supporting its development.

MedicAlert exists to provide peace of mind and to save lives by providing vital medical details to emergency services, for people with a range of health conditions and allergies. MedicAlert also keeps secure detailed medical records for our members. This information can be accessed in an emergency, 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, from anywhere in the world.

MedicAlert provide assurance and life saving support to thousands of members each year. We understand that sometimes you need to get really important information to those helping you, but in an emergency you might not be able to speak for yourself.

We provide services and jewellery to help ensure your wishes are followed should the unexpected happen.

Wearing your MedicAlert jewellery allows emergency personnel to obtain initial information from the disc on your bracelet or necklace, with further detail being available via the electronic record you hold with us.

Our team of nurses review your information to make sure you have the right wording on your disc and clear details in your record.

This means you can alert emergency professionals to your individual needs whether it be that you have a medical condition, allergies, heart device or want those treating you to know how to reach your next of kin, absolutely vital if you can't speak for yourself.
